The newest promo for Free Guy, from director Shawn Levy, offers the first comprehensive look at the film’s plot. Reynolds’ Guy doesn’t just realize he’s a NPC (non-playable character) in a game called “Free City.” He falls in love with Jodie Comer’s Molotov Girl (her in-game avatar), which leads to him upending the entire digital realm. That makes “blue shirt” a star in the real world. But Guy’s awakening threatens the very existence of his own.

The game’s owner, played by Taika Waititi (What We Do in the Shadows), wants to shut it all down rather than let a character’s “great guy” routine stop players from killing and blowing things up with impunity.

Free Guy also stars Joe Keery (Stranger Things), Lil Rel Howery (Get Out), and Utkarsh Ambudkar (Pitch Perfect). It’s scheduled to hit theaters later this year, on December 11.
